Shloka (श्लोक)

शरैष्ठ्यं पराप्य सवजातीनां भुक्त्वा भॊगान अनुत्तमान
हृतस्वबलराज्यस तवं बरूहि तस्मान न शॊचसि

Translations

English Translation

In this verse, it states that even after experiencing tremendous enjoyments and achieving greatness pertaining to one’s clan, there should be no grief about losing earthly connections. This speaks to the transient nature of worldly attachments.
